What You’ll Experience

  • Village Museum (Muzeul Satului): A vast open-air collection of over 300 rural houses, mills, churches, and workshops relocated from across Romania. Walk through six centuries of folk architecture and hear stories of Romanian rural life, brought to life by your guide.
  • Ceaușescu’s Spring Palace: The secret residence of communist dictator Nicolae Ceaușescu and his wife, hidden behind high walls in a leafy Bucharest neighborhood. Discover the contrast between the regime’s propaganda and the luxury enjoyed by its leaders, including security details and opulent rooms.
  • Palace of Parliament: The world’s second-largest administrative building, constructed under Ceaușescu. Explore its immense underground levels, massive chandeliers, and extensive corridors, reflecting one of history’s most ambitious construction projects.
